How they compare
France currently reports 9.69 against 9.45 in Hungary, a difference of 0.24.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 71 shared years of data; in 1950 it was Hungary ahead.
France ranks 16th and Hungary ranks 19th of 41 countries.
Across the 8 decades both report, France averaged higher in 6 and Hungary in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| France | Hungary |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1950s | 18.99 | 19.53 | 0.5349 | Hungary |
| 1960s | 17.69 | 13.94 | 3.74 | France |
| 1970s | 15.28 | 16.07 | 0.7806 | Hungary |
| 1980s | 14.12 | 12.38 | 1.74 | France |
| 1990s | 12.78 | 10.81 | 1.98 | France |
| 2000s | 12.83 | 9.62 | 3.21 | France |
| 2010s | 11.91 | 9.16 | 2.75 | France |
| 2020s | 10.68 | 9.45 | 1.23 | France |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
